In Vitro Biotransformation and Anti-Inflammatory Activity of Constituents and Metabolites of <i>Filipendula ulmaria</i>

(1) Background: <i>Filipendula ulmaria</i> (L.) Maxim. (Rosaceae) (meadowsweet) is widely used in phytotherapy against inflammatory diseases. However, its active constituents are not exactly known. Moreover, it contains many constituents, such as flavonoid glycosides, which are not absor...
